DRETOP TLG-9965A Vertical Forced-Air Drying Oven

Add to wishlistAdded to wishlistRemoved from wishlist 0
Add to compare
Brand DRETOP
Origin Shanghai, China
Manufacturer Type Direct Manufacturer
Product Category Domestic
Model TLG-9965A
Instrument Type Standard Bench/Free-Standing Oven
Temperature Range RT+10°C to 300°C
Temperature Uniformity ±2.5°C (empty chamber @ 100°C)
Temperature Fluctuation ±0.5°C
Temperature Resolution 0.1°C
External Dimensions 1185 × 880 × 1950 mm
Internal Chamber Dimensions 1000 × 600 × 1600 mm
Operating Ambient Temperature 5–45°C
Interior Material Stainless Steel (SUS304)
Heating Method Forced-Air Circulation with High-Temperature Fan and Optimized Airflow Duct Design

Overview

The DRETOP TLG-9965A Vertical Forced-Air Drying Oven is an engineered solution for precise, repeatable thermal processing in research laboratories, quality control environments, and industrial R&D settings. Designed around the principle of convection-driven heat transfer, this oven utilizes a high-efficiency axial fan capable of continuous operation at elevated temperatures, coupled with a thermally optimized airflow channel system that ensures uniform heat distribution throughout the working chamber. Unlike natural convection ovens, the TLG-9965A employs forced-air circulation to minimize thermal gradients—critical for applications requiring strict adherence to ASTM E145, ISO 17025, or internal SOPs governing drying, curing, baking, and stabilization protocols. Its vertical free-standing architecture accommodates large-volume samples while maintaining footprint efficiency, making it suitable for integration into GLP-compliant labs where spatial constraints and operational traceability are key considerations.

Key Features

  • Microprocessor-based P.I.D. temperature controller with LCD display, offering real-time three-color parameter visualization (setpoint, actual temperature, elapsed time) and intuitive menu navigation.
  • Self-diagnostic system with fault-code readout on the display panel, enabling rapid identification of sensor drift, heater failure, or fan interruption without external instrumentation.
  • Dual-stage door locking mechanism with zinc-alloy handle and high-temperature silicone rubber gasket (rated to 350°C), ensuring consistent chamber sealing and minimizing thermal leakage during extended dwell cycles.
  • Double-layer tempered glass observation window with integrated anti-fog coating, allowing non-intrusive visual monitoring while preserving thermal integrity and operator safety.
  • Adjustable, slide-out stainless steel shelving system (SUS304) with tool-free height repositioning; all trays are removable for autoclaving or chemical decontamination.
  • Back-mounted exhaust port compatible with standard 50 mm ducting, supporting controlled venting of volatile compounds or moisture-laden air—particularly relevant for polymer curing, solvent evaporation, or pharmaceutical stability testing per ICH Q1 guidelines.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The TLG-9965A accommodates a broad range of sample types—including electronic components, metal alloys, polymer specimens, ceramic powders, food matrices, and coated substrates—without risk of cross-contamination or thermal degradation. Its stainless-steel interior and seamless chamber construction meet basic hygienic design requirements outlined in FDA 21 CFR Part 11 for data-integrity-critical operations when paired with optional USB logging or RS485 communication modules. The unit complies with CE marking directives (2014/30/EU EMC and 2014/35/EU LVD), and its electrical insulation and grounding architecture conform to IEC 61010-1 for laboratory equipment safety. While not certified for Class I Division 1 hazardous locations, it is routinely deployed in non-explosive ambient conditions meeting ISO 14644-1 Class 8 cleanroom support roles.

Software & Data Management

The base configuration includes a built-in timer (1–9999 minutes) and over-temperature cut-off protection with audible/visual alarm. Optional upgrades expand digital functionality: a programmable multi-segment controller supports up to 30 ramp-hold cycles for complex thermal profiles; a USB data export interface enables direct CSV file transfer to external PCs for post-test analysis in Excel or MATLAB; and an RS485 serial port permits integration into centralized lab management systems via Modbus RTU protocol. When equipped with the optional color touchscreen module, the oven supports audit-trail-enabled operation logs—including user ID, timestamp, setpoint changes, and alarm events—aligned with ALCOA+ principles for data reliability under GMP/GLP frameworks.

Applications

This drying oven serves validated thermal processes across multiple sectors: moisture content determination per AOAC 950.46 and USP ; pre-conditioning of test coupons prior to tensile or adhesion testing (ASTM D638, D3359); aging studies for elastomers and composites (ASTM D573, D865); residual solvent removal from pharmaceutical intermediates; drying of filter papers and chromatography media; and thermal stabilization of calibration standards. Its stable ±0.5°C fluctuation and ±2.5°C uniformity at 100°C make it appropriate for routine QC workflows where reproducibility—not ultra-high precision—is the primary performance criterion.

FAQ

What is the maximum operating temperature and corresponding thermal class rating?
The TLG-9965A is rated for continuous operation up to 300°C. Its heating elements, insulation, and fan motor are classified for Class H (180°C) insulation, with derated performance margins ensuring long-term reliability at peak load.
Can the oven be validated for IQ/OQ/PQ protocols?
Yes—the unit supports third-party validation through accessible PT100 sensor ports (optional), mechanical timer verification, and documented temperature mapping using calibrated reference probes per ISO/IEC 17025-accredited methods.
Is the stainless-steel interior electropolished or passivated?
The SUS304 chamber undergoes standard acid pickling and passivation per ASTM A967, providing corrosion resistance suitable for repeated exposure to mildly acidic or saline residues.
Does the forced-air system include variable-speed fan control?
No—the fan operates at fixed speed to maintain consistent airflow velocity across the specified temperature range; however, airflow direction and duct geometry are optimized to prevent localized turbulence or cold spots.
What documentation is provided for regulatory submissions?
DRETOP supplies a Factory Acceptance Test (FAT) report, electrical safety certification summary, material compliance statement (RoHS/REACH), and English-language operation manual with maintenance schedules—all essential for lab accreditation audits.
